Choosing The Right Roofing Company For Slate Roof Repair

Even talking about repairing a roof gives some homeowners a chill down their spine.  However, it doesn't have to be like that.  There are roofing companies out there that are ready to take on your project and do it in a manner that is cost effective, and will meet the quality standards that you deserve.  From slate roof repair, to standard shingle installation, there is not a job that cannot be completed to bring the relief that you need.


Because there are so many different kinds of scenarios and situations that can arise with every roofing project it's important to consult a qualified specialist for the specific situation you find yourself in.  When dealing with something a little more advanced like slate roof repair you are going to not only need somebody who specializes in slate roof repair, but has a track record of doing a great job.  Many times when slate starts to get old home owners opt out of slate, and go with something a little easier to maintain like a standard shingle.  However, the overall durability and amount of time that slate will last is far greater than a standard shingle.  But the downside is the price point up front, and the need for slate roof repair should something happen.


The benefits of having a slate roof are many.  The overall durability of them are almost unmatched.  Not only are resistant to hail, but they can also resist fire.  There are not many roofing surfaces that can brag those two claims.  When a roofing surface can resist the toughest of storms you are less likely to need slate roof repair, like you would when a conventional shingle.  However, the overall cost of installing new slate, or even paying for slate roof repair is enough to keep many new home builders away from this material.

Strengths and Weaknesses of this Type of Roofing Material


The strengths are simple in the fact that it's going to last for a long time, and withstand just about anything mother nature can throw at it.  The weakness's are the price point for the cost up front, or the cost of slate roof repair.  Overall a great buy, but not great for everyone.
